About Cornerstone Healing Center – Addiction & Mental Health Scottsdale
Cornerstone Healing Center’s Addiction & Mental Health program in Scottsdale, Arizona, provides licensed and accredited drug rehab and mental health support services to adults. This includes those with chronic relapse, or those struggling with homelessness.
Most insurance providers are gladly taken. Self-pay options are also available for those who may be short on funds.
Accredited Addiction Treatment East of Phoenix
A standout element of this facility, I believe, is its comprehensive and holistic approach to care. This, and its accreditation by The Joint Commission, assures my confidence in the quality of care offered overall.
For those needing more intensive support, residential treatment options are available, ensuring 24/7 supervised care and immersion. There’s even a swimming pool out front and a keen desert landscape. Structured housing and supportive residential environments are also available to individuals seeking stability throughout outpatient programming.
Holistic Care & Extended Recovery Support
The facility favors a holistic approach to care across all of its programs. This means clients may engage in fitness and nutrition sessions, as well as guided meditation to help quiet and calm their minds and nervous systems. Yoga is also featured alongside wellness coaching and educational and life skills sessions. Medication-assisted treatment (MAT) is also available, and clients can access aftercare services for up to a year post-programming.
